Did you know that the fats it contains are mainly MCTs (medium chain triglycerides), half of which are lauric acid, which increases metabolism and are more easily digested than other fats? They also don't lead to belly fat like long chain triglycerides. The only other rich source of lauric acid is breast milk, which is why coconut oil is often part of commercial formulas.
